A driver, who is yet top be identified has crushed two female officials of the Lagos Waste Management Authority, LAWMA to death, while attempting to escape a raid by officers of the Lagos State Traffic Management Agency (LASTMA).

An eyewitness said the two yet-to-be-identified women died on the spot.

Advertisement

The incident happened around the Charlie Boy bus-stop via Oshodi- Gbagada expressway in Lagos State on Monday.

The lifeless bodies of the cleaners were seen laid in a drainage channel as onlookers mourned.

A 12-year-old girl was hit to death by bullets during a fierce gun battle between police operatives of Edo State Command and suspected kidnappers along the Obe Hill by pipeline leading to Ajaokuta.

This was contained in a statement made available to newsmen by the Edo State Command’s Police Public Relations Officer, SP Moses Yamu.

Advertisement

Yamu, in the statement said 14 persons were rescued from the suspected kidnappers during the shootout.

According to him, the police got a distress call that some armed men were terrorising Fugar-Agenebode Road, Etsako East Local Government Area of the state, which, according to him, they quickly responded to save the day.

On 11/07/2025 at about 1920hrs, upon receiving a distress call that armed men blocked the Fugar-Agenebode road, Etsako East Local Government Area, the Command immediately mobilised a combined team of police operatives from Agenebode, local vigilantes, and hunters who responded swiftly and pursued the assailants into the forest.

“During the encounter, a gun duel ensued along Obe Hill by pipeline leading to Ajaokuta, the security team successfully rescued fourteen (14) kidnapped passengers alive.

“Unfortunately, a 12-year-old girl was fatally shot by the fleeing kidnappers during the crossfire.

Advertisement

“One female victim is still unaccounted for, and search efforts are ongoing to ensure her safe rescue.

“This follows the report that armed men suspected to be kidnappers ambushed and blocked the highway, opened fire on unsuspecting commuters, killing two persons on the spot and abducting others in a brazen act of violence”, Yamu said.

The Matero Local Court in Zambia, has heard that a man allegedly connived with his family to lie to his second wife that he was single.

According to Zambia Observer, Linda Mulenga, 30, giving evidence in the case where her husband, Lameck Mwale, 39, sued her for reconciliation, said she started losing interest in her marriage upon discovering that she was a second wife.

Advertisement

But Lameck said he still loved his wife and did not think that divorce was the solution to their current problem.

The couple got married in 2015 and has one child.

A Sharia Court sitting at Rigasa, Kaduna, Kaduna State, has dissolved a –one-year-old marriage, over the husband’s inability to provide for his wife.

According to the News Agency of Nigeria (NAN), the judge, Salisu Abubakar-Tureta, delivering judgment, granted the prayer of Mariya Zhulyadaini for divorce from Jamilu Hassan.

Advertisement

Mariya in her petition prayed the court for divorce because her husband did not provide her the three square meals.
